日期:2014-05-17  浏览次数:21565 次

spring 登录loadUserByUsername函数增加参数
目前implements UserDetailsService这个接口,重写loadUserByUsername函数,但是这个函数只有username一个参数,而我实际项目中还需要一个公司id传进来进行和数据库验证。
请问有什么方法吗?

------解决方案--------------------
在可以在接口中定义,然后在继承后的类另实现这个方法,或者直接在继承的类中直接重载一个方法


前台input 定义一个name 后台可以通过 HttpServletRequest.getParameter("name")
------解决方案--------------------
探讨

其实,我要实现的效果就是,我前台jsp页面不光有用户名和密码,还有部门编号,我需要根据部门编号和用户名去查找数据库(先不管我的业务啊),所以我这里不光要有username,还需要有deptid传进来。
谢谢了。